> Spark SQL does not correctly set job description and scheduler pool

> Spark SQL current sets the scheduler pool and job description AFTER jobs run 
> (see 
> https://github.com/apache/spark/blob/master/sql/hive-thriftserver/v0.13.1/src/main/scala/org/apache/spark/sql/hive/thriftserver/Shim13.scala#L168
>  -- which happens after calling hiveContext.sql).  As a result, the 
> description for a SQL job ends up being the SQL query corresponding to the 
> previous job.  This should be done before the job is run so the description 
> is correct.
